Software, Updates, and the Ecosystem
One of the defining strengths of the XDA Pixel Pro is its software trajectory. It often ships with a near-stock base but gains access to community-driven enhancements. Developers and enthusiasts contribute to a broad ecosystem of ROMs, kernels, and tweaks that extend the life of the device beyond typical OEM update cycles. For many users, this means faster access to new Android features, improved customization options, and the ability to address device-specific quirks through tailored builds.
From the perspective of updates, the XDA Pixel Pro often benefits from independent software channels that cater to a wide range of preferences. Users can choose ROMs that emphasize stability, performance, or cutting-edge features, such as Pixel Experience variants, LineageOS derivatives, or other AOSP-based options. The inclusion of tooling like Magisk for systemless root and modular kernel projects enables a hands-on approach to performance tuning and feature experimentation, all within a supportive community framework.

Getting Started: A Practical Roadmap
If you are new to the XDA Pixel Pro, here is a practical roadmap to begin exploring responsibly:
- Research ROM options: Look at well-supported builds with active maintenance and clear documentation.
- Check compatibility: Ensure the ROM supports your exact device variant and base Android version.
- Back up data: Create a reliable backup strategy before flashing any ROM or modifying partitions.
- Learn the basics: Familiarize yourself with bootloader status, recovery modes, and how to verify integrity of downloads.
- Engage with the community: Read guides, post questions, and learn from experienced users who have walked the same path.
